
The Pension Fund Regulatory and Improvement Authority (PFRDA) has lately introduced
New pointers for countrywide Pension Machine (NPS) subscribers who surrender their indian citizenship.
Those pointers make clear the system for ultimate NPS bills for those who no longer keep indian citizenship and have now not obtained an Overseas Citizen of india (OCI) card.
Renouncing indian citizenship is a legal process wherein a character voluntarily offers up their indian nationality, generally after obtaining citizenship of any other U.S.A. india does not now permit dual citizenship, so this method is required when a person desires to become a citizen of every other state.
"In appreciation of such subscribers who have validly renounced their indian citizenship and no longer maintain an OCI card, the said subscriber is required to forthwith intimate the countrywide pension machine belief (NPS accepts as true) of the trade-in status at the side of proof thereof, and the PRAN/NPS account held by means of the subscriber shall be closed, and the entire gathered pension wealth may be transferred to a non-resident regular (NRO) account most effectively," said PFRDA in a round dated april 21, 2025.
WHO CAN OPEN AN NPS ACCOUNT IN INDIA?
Any indian citizen between 18 and 70 years old can open an NPS account.
Moreover, Non-Resident indians (NRIs) and Overseas Residents of india (OCIs) also can open an NPS account, as long as they meet the necessary requirements set through the PFRDA.
If a subscriber renounces their indian citizenship, they want to observe a few steps to close their NPS account.
First off, they should practice for account closure by way of filing an undertaking confirming that they have given up their indian citizenship and do not own an OCI card.
They'll also need to provide proof of their renunciation, consisting of a renunciation certificate, a give-up certificate, or a cancelled indian passport.
"The subscriber shall put up a utility for closure of his/her NPS account along with the following extra files to NPS belief: A venture pointing out that s/he has renounced his/her indian citizenship and does now not maintain an OCI card. valid certificate of Renunciation of indian Citizenship/give-up certificates/cancelled indian passport, issued via equipped authority," noted the circular.
As soon as the NPS considers and the important recordkeeping corporations (CRAs) affirm those documents, the account could be closed, and the pension finances may be transferred to the subscriber's non-resident regular (NRO) account. This switch will observe the policies laid out underneath the Foreign Exchange Management Act (FEMA).
